Portsmouth Pum p Station Master Plan, Portsm outh NH
Project engineer in the development of a comprehensive City-wide pump station
master plan for eighteen municipal wastewater pump stations including
submersible, wet-pit/dry-pit, and suction-lift style pump stations. Pump Station
evaluations included reviews of pump station process equipment and building
components, force main evaluations, development of a complete infrastructure
asset inventory, equipment and force main criticality assessments, current and
future pumping capacity needs, and pump station improvement recommendations
which are summarized in 10-year budgetary Pump Station Capital Improvement
Plan.
Influe nt How Evaluation Study, Hampton NH
Project engineer responsible for developing an evaluation of the Town’s effluent
flow meter in comparison to the influent flow. This required the installation of 2
sewer manhole flow meters and the statistical analysis and reporting of results.
Pump Station and WWTF Asset Management Assistance, Claremont, NH
Project engineer assisting with the conditional assessment of wastewater
infrastructure, including 8 wastewater pump stations and treatment facility.
Responsibilities included site inspections, equipment condition evaluations, and
development of a Business Risk Exposure (BRE) analysis.
